网站维护是保障网站正常运行的重要环节,它涉及到网站的稳定运行、数据安全、功能更新等多个方面。对于很多新手来说,网站维护可能是一个陌生的领域。那么,网站维护究竟怎么操作呢?接下来,我们将从以下几个方面进行详细的介绍。
一、网站备份
网站备份是网站维护的基础工作,也是保证数据安全的重要手段。定期进行网站备份,可以在网站数据丢失或受到损坏时,快速恢复数据。网站备份的方法有很多,常用的有手动备份和自动备份。
1. 手动备份
手动备份是指人工将网站文件复制到本地或其他存储设备。具体操作步骤如下:
(1)登录到网站服务器,找到网站根目录;
(2)使用FTP或其他方式,将网站根目录下的所有文件和文件夹复制到本地或其他存储设备;
(3)将备份文件命名,并标注备份时间,以便于日后恢复时使用。
2. 自动备份
自动备份是通过脚本或软件自动将网站数据备份到本地或其他存储设备。具体操作步骤如下:
(1)选择一款适合自己需求的备份软件,如: Duplicity、Rsync等;
(2)设置备份时间、频率、目标存储设备等参数;
(3)运行备份软件,开始自动备份。
二、服务器监控
服务器监控是指对网站服务器进行实时监测,发现并解决问题。常用的服务器监控工具有:
1. 系统资源监控:如CPU使用率、内存使用率、磁盘空间使用情况等;
2. 网络监控:如网络流量、网络延迟、丢包率等;
3. 应用程序监控:如Apache、Nginx、MySQL等服务的运行状态。
三、安全防护
网站安全是网站维护的重中之重。在网站维护过程中,需要做好以下安全防护工作:
1. 更新软件:定期更新服务器上的软件,修复已知漏洞;
2. 安装防火墙:使用防火墙,如:iptables、UFW等,阻止非法访问;
3. 定期备份:如前文所述,定期备份网站数据,防止数据丢失;
4. 密码策略:使用复杂度较高的密码,并定期更改,防止密码泄露;
5. 防止SQL注入:对用户输入的数据进行过滤和验证,防止SQL注入攻击;
6. 防止跨站脚本攻击(XSS):对用户提交的数据进行编码处理,防止XSS攻击。
四、网站优化
2. 使用缓存:如:Memcached、Redis等缓存技术,提高访问速度;
4. 选择合适的主机:根据网站访问量、地域等因素,选择合适的主机,提高访问速度。
五、功能更新与维护
随着网站的发展,可能需要对网站功能进行更新和维护。具体操作如下:
1. 分析需求:了解用户需求,确定需要更新的功能;
2. 制定计划:规划功能更新时间、步骤等;
3. 开发与测试:按照计划进行功能开发,同时进行测试,确保功能正常运行;
4. 部署上线:将更新后的功能部署到生产环境,并观察运行情况。
六、结语
网站维护是一个长期且繁琐的过程,需要站长们耐心、细致地进行。通过以上介绍,相信大家对网站维护已经有了一个基本的了解。在实际操作过程中,还需要不断学习、总结经验,才能更好地维护自己的网站。最后,祝大家的网站都能越办越好!
本文来自投稿,不代表聚客号立场,如若转载,请注明出处:http://www.jukehao.com/3891.html